The DSAX110 57120001-P operates at the intersection of the field layer and the control layer, where analog signals from pressure transmitters, temperature sensors, flow meters, and valve positioners must be accurately digitized and delivered to the DCS processor without latency or signal degradation. Within the ABB Advant architecture, this board slots into the AC 450 or AC 460 controller backplane, working in concert with the DSMB 127 MasterBus 300 communication module to relay process data upstream to the supervisory network.
At the field level, instruments such as ABB 266 series pressure transmitters and TTF300 temperature field transmitters feed 4–20 mA signals directly into the DSAX110’s analog input channels. These signals are conditioned, scaled, and passed to the DSPC 172 processor board — the computational core of the Advant controller — where control algorithms execute PID loops, cascade control, and feedforward strategies based on real-time process values.
For remote I/O expansion across large plant footprints, the DSAX110 57120001-P integrates with DSTD 108 digital I/O modules and DSDO 115 digital output boards mounted in distributed I/O cabinets, all communicating back to the central controller via the AF 100 Advant Fieldbus. This architecture eliminates the need for long analog cable runs, reducing signal noise and installation costs while maintaining deterministic data delivery.
At the supervisory layer, the ABB Advant Station 500 series operator workstation — running the MasterView 800 HMI software — receives real-time analog process data from the DSAX110 via the controller’s communication stack. SCADA integration is achieved through the DSCOM 100 communication gateway, which bridges the Advant network to Ethernet-based SCADA platforms using OPC DA/UA protocols, enabling plant-wide data aggregation, alarm management, and historical trending.
For drive-level integration, the DSAX110’s analog outputs connect to ABB ACS800 series variable frequency drives, providing speed reference signals and enabling closed-loop process control for pump, fan, and compressor applications. This analog command link ensures smooth drive response and eliminates the communication latency that can occur with purely digital command interfaces in time-critical process loops.
Power integrity for the entire I/O subsystem is maintained by the DSPU 100 power supply unit, which provides regulated 24 VDC to the backplane and all installed I/O boards including the DSAX110. Redundant power configurations are supported, ensuring that a single power supply failure does not interrupt analog signal acquisition — a critical requirement in continuous process industries where unplanned shutdowns carry significant financial and safety consequences.

Q1: Is the ABB DSAX110 57120001-P compatible with both AC 450 and AC 460 Advant controllers?
A: Yes. The DSAX110 57120001-P is designed for use within the ABB Advant DCS controller family, including the AC 450 and AC 460 platforms. It installs into the standard Advant backplane and communicates with the processor board via the internal bus. Before installation, verify the backplane slot configuration and firmware revision of your controller to ensure full compatibility. Q2: What communication protocols does the DSAX110 support for SCADA and HMI integration?
A: The DSAX110 57120001-P operates within the ABB Advant Fieldbus (AF 100) and MasterBus 300 network architecture. For integration with modern SCADA and HMI systems, the Advant controller communicates via the DSCOM 100 gateway using OPC DA/UA, Modbus TCP, or PROFIBUS DP protocol bridges. This enables the DSAX110’s analog data to be accessed by any SCADA platform supporting these standard industrial protocols, including Wonderware, iFIX, and Ignition.
